To manage the human resources function of the Company ad promote a conducive working environment and a skilled and motivated workforce to ensure the achievement the company’s strategic objectives.
Description:
Key Duties
· Develop and implement a HR strategy based on the overall Company strategy to ensure that business needs are met
· Develop a HR budget based on the strategy and effectively manage it to ensure cost management goals are achieved
· Develop and implement HR management policies and procedures and monitor all HR activities and practices to ensure compliance.
· Manage the recruitment process in a manner that ensures that right calibre of employees is hired and that new employees receive proper instructions regarding their duties and terms of employment.
· Generate policies and procedures for performance management process and all related functions including staff appraisal, training planning and implementation and incentive schemes.
· Manage industrial relations matters and offer training, advice and general guidance to managers and supervisors on labour laws and related market practices so as to ensure a harmonious work environment.
· Oversee and coordinate employee welfare, device and run welfare schemes to facilitate amelioration of difficulties of the employees in non-work situations and manage disciplinary matters across the Company.
· Handle staff grievances in a prompt, conscientious manner while paying heed to the company’s business needs and policies.
· Train managers and supervisors on basic staff management and disciplinary skills.
· Continually review and update the terms and conditions of service of employees to ensure that the Company remains within common market practice and communicate to the staff appropriately.
· Continually review pay and reward systems that are in place within the company so as to ensure that these remain competitive and affordable.

Requirements:
Knowledge/Skills/Experience
· A Degree/Post Graduation Degree in Human Resources Management
· Degree/diploma in law is preferred
· At least 8 years of experience, 5 of which must be in a managerial position
· Proven experience in industrial relations-CBA negotiations, industrial dispute resolution is a must.
· Should have a sound knowledge in Talent Acquisition, Talent Management and Learning and Development Processes
· A person who is adaptable, self motivated and team player
· High degree of integrity, business acumen, proficiency in English, Very good communication and interpersonal skills, Negotiation Skills, Expert Knowledge in Labor Laws and ILO Standards (preferred)
· Global understanding of HR aspects and recent concepts of HR
